Laravel是最好的PHP框架的12个理由

Laravel被认为是最好的PHP框架之一。让我们看看为什么。

如今,任何企业茁壮成长的网站至关重要。以优秀的方式在搜索引擎中执行的良好开发的网站是组织的首要任务。尽管如此,谈论 Web开发过程,有各个方面应该考虑到。 

随着技术的持续发展,企业每天争取以保持竞争优势,坚持在线环境和市场的独特和最佳方法,以达到预期的结果是至关重要的。但是,就像其他任何东西一样,拥有最好的网站也意味着会有障碍克服。 

此外,涉及到编程语言和构建交互式和高性能网站的编程语言和框架时,有很多选择。最好的是PHP框架,特别是Laravel。有几个 专门的Laravel开发商 总是向前迈进 使网络开发有效。 

Laravel,Web Artisan

Laravel,PHP的开源Web框架,尝试提供更高级的替代方案。大多数建筑模式都是基于 symfony.。在三次版本之后,该框架成为流行的,其中包括数据库系统和迁移支持等功能,这是一个命令行界面。 

而且,它包括捆绑包装,包装系统。对a的需求 LARAVEL应用开发公司 随着越来越多的客户更愿意为其Web开发项目使用它。 

Laravel有51192个GitHub Stars。

下面,找出主要的技术福利,使LARURAR是PHP所有其他框架中的最佳框架。 

十几个原因为什么小旅行是最好的

1)授权方法

通过LARAVEL,使实现认证方法非常简单。几乎一切都很令人震惊。该框架提供了一种简单的控制访问组织的方式,以及资源授权逻辑。 

2)工匠

这是一个开发人员的构建工具 可以使用与命令行与Laravel进行交互,该命令行构建和处理项目。工匠允许做出重复和费力的大部分编程任务,许多开发人员避免手动执行。  

3)安全

在开发应用程序时,每个人都应该使用一些其他方式来保护应用程序。 Laravel在使用散列和盐渍框架内处理安全性。这意味着密码永远不会被保存为普通数据库文本。 Bcrypt散列算法用于生成加密密码表示。 

LARAVEL利用准备的SQL语句,使得不可思议的注射攻击。框架以及此框架还具有逃离用户输入的无缝方式,以避免用户注入标签<script>. 

4)面向对象的库

由于其面向对象的图书馆以及预先安装的其他原因,制作LARAVE的最佳原因之一,并在任何其他流行的PHP框架中找到。预安装的库之一是身份验证库。虽然它很容易实现,但它有很多高级功能,包括Bcrypt散列,活动用户,密码重置,加密,保护和CSRF或跨站点请求伪造。 

5)数据库迁移

在一个 LARAVEL DEVELOPMENT公司,开发人员的一个痛点是将数据库保持在开发机之间的同步。随着LARAVEL的数据库迁移,它非常容易。对数据库可能有许多更改。迁移更改了任何其他开发机器,这就是为什么Laravel被视为PHP的最佳框架。 

6)模型 - 视图控制器支持

MVC架构支持是Laravel是最好的框架的另一个原因。例如,与symfony一样,它确保了演示文稿和逻辑之间的清晰度。此外,MVC有助于提高性能,实现更好的文档,以及内置的众多功能。 

7)负责任的界面

5.5版本版本的新增功能。它是用于实现可以通过控制器方法返回的接口的类。之后,路由器将在准备“Illuminate \ Routing \ Router”的响应时检查负责任实例。 

8)伟大的教程

开发人员应该了解更多以提供更多。与其他框架不同,Laravel提供了Laracast,它可以结合自由和付费视频教程的组合如何使用该框架。 Jeffrey Way是一名经验丰富的专家教练,使这是视频。生产质量很高,凭借有意义,深思熟虑的课程。

9)刀片模板引擎

它非常直观,有助于更好地使用典型的PHP / HTML意大利面。对于需要用HTML切换一个IF语句的开发人员,这项工作是繁琐的。然而,用刀片,这很容易。这就是它的工作原理。 

@if(Auth::check())

// show the html you want for when the user is logged in.

@else

// show other html when the user is not logged in.

@endif

10)自动包发现

Laravel 5.5的新功能会自动检测用户想要安装的软件包。这意味着用户现在不需要设置任何提供者或别名来安装新的Laravel软件包。此外,框架使能实现 专门的Laravel开发商 禁用特定包的功能。 

11)活跃社区

事实上,Laravel有一个活跃的社区。每当您面临开发过程中的问题时,有很多堆栈溢出帖子要退出。除了活跃的堆栈溢出社区,还有LaraCasts讨论论坛,您可以免费注册。 

12)依赖管理作曲家

Laravel利用作曲家管理依赖关系,以及自动加载。 Composer有助于安装Laravel包,使得依赖于一块蛋糕的管理。  

您可以在任何时间点检查Package.json文件,并查看应用程序使用的所有依赖项。此外,Composer提供了能够使用单个Composer命令更新依赖项的益处。 

总结

这些天,当涉及到Web开发过程时,企业正在寻找定制软件开发服务提供商,可以使用PHP的Laravel框架帮助开发服务。上面提到的功能是明确和明显的原因,为什么Laravel在PHP的其他开发框架中突出。 

它提供了更多的网站提供了更多的安全性,并以更快的速度涵盖所有要求。对于任何企业在当今艰难的市场竞争中茁壮成长,与一个小型开发服务提供商合作就是去的方式。

欢迎您的意见!

MediSign  -  ehr用于小医疗实践

EHR用于小医疗实践

病历。约会。电子发票。

每月9美元